High stress levels trigger the release of cortisol, which suppresses the immune system and delays wound healing. Minimizing fear during veterinary visits directly improves clinical outcomes.

In the wild, animals exhibit a range of behaviors that are shaped by their evolution, environment, and social structures. Domestication has altered the behavior of many species, and animals kept as pets or used in agriculture often exhibit behaviors that are influenced by their human caregivers. For example, a dog's behavior can be shaped by its owner's interactions, training, and environment, while a cow's behavior can be influenced by its living conditions, feeding practices, and social interactions.

: Pioneered by experts like Dr. Temple Grandin, utilizing knowledge of a prey animal’s "flight zone" and "point of balance" allows handlers to move cattle smoothly without shouting or prodding. This reduces stress, lowers injury rates for both humans and animals, and improves meat quality.

Animals learn by associating their actions with consequences. This involves positive reinforcement (adding a reward to repeat a behavior) and negative punishment (removing something desirable to stop a behavior). Modern veterinary science heavily favors reward-based methods over aversive techniques.

: Cats are solitary predators that need vertical territory, scratching surfaces, and regular predatory play simulation to avoid anxiety-induced conditions like feline idiopathic cystitis (bladder inflammation).
